Nnmetodologia agile kanban pdf

Kanban is a lean software development methodology that focuses on justintime delivery of functionality and managing the amount of work in progress wip. Kanban literally signboard or billboard in japanese was developed in the 1940s by taiichi ohno at toyota as a system to improve and maintain a high level of production. Personal kanban personal relates to personal value is a visual representation of work. Kanban japanese, signboard or billboard is a lean method to manage and improve work across human systems. Getting started with kanban 5 project may be, creating a kanban board allows you to see the status of the work being done at a glance.

The most popular of them are scrum and kanban while scrumban is. The principles ams refer to were written in 2001 in. Vul hieronder je emailadres in en ontvang het bestand pdf. Kanban, lean, software development, agile methodologies 1 introduction agile methodologies is a name referring to a set of practices and processes for software development that have been created by experienced practitioners. The goal of this talk to convince you that you can add more value to life by visualizing your workflow that you will learn what personal kanban is, the meaning behind it and how it can be used to improve your workflow and effectiveness that you will try visualize your workflow when you leave this room and start gaining. Personal kanban is based on the principles and techniques of lean methodology, a philosophy and a discipline that increases access to information to ensure responsible decisionmaking while creating value. This practice is gaining popularity in software development wherein the agile iteration approach and kanban value stream focus are combined. Kesavan address for correspondence 1,2 research scholar,3asst. However, leankor incorporates it into a software program that presents the information in a logical layout and provides a visual demonstration of how the product works. There are different frameworks and methods utilized in agile. Scrum, kanban, lean and xp course is offered multiple times in a variety of locations and training topics. Due to a series of unfortunate events the article wasnt published in the magazine it. Professor, department of production technology, anna university, mit campus, chennai44, tamilnadu email.

From agile to scrum to waterfall to kanban, there are a. Kanban 3 alignment with agile in agile, if values are combined with kanban characteristics, the outcome would be agile kanban. Mary poppendieck had referred to a card wall as a kanban board in her lean software development book. Your contribution will go a long way in helping us. Like scrum, kanban is a process designed to help teams work together more effectively. Our 23 point agile diagnostic provides a comprehensive view of your capabilities today and a roadmap for continuous improvement that is aligned to your business objectives. Some time ago we met a person from our clients management team. Kanban as a tool in the agile toolbox cognizant 2020 insights executive summary the ability of a software development team to be agile has an attraction at an elemental level.

Maybe with some xp extreme programming thrown in if you are feeling brave. While lean methodologies were developed in manufacturing environments, many lean. Moreover, our survey reveals that agile advocates striving to further expand agile working methods constitute a disproportionately high quota. Lean manufacturing is more than a set of tools and. The goal of this talk to convince you that you can add more value to life by visualizing your workflow that you will learn what personal kanban is, the meaning behind it and how it can be. Jul 14, 2017 understanding kanban method or kanban framework for software development.

Kanban tool user manual o tomorrow limited number of things scheduled for tomorrow o today things to do today with limit of 7 cards to keep you focused and organized in progress with limit to keep you from doing too many things at the same time. Lean development practices are based on the lean methodologies that have been used successfully in manufacturing processes. Kanban an alternative to the agile model of project. Overview on kanban methodology and its implementation. And one of the first decisions youll make is choosing which project management methodology to follow. Agile, exploratory research, kanban, lean, mixed methods, portfolio management, software development, software maintenance. With personal kanban, you always know your priorities and what you should be doing now and next. Our 23 point agile diagnostic provides a comprehensive view of your capabilities today and a roadmap for continuous improvement that is. Kanban is a method for managing the creation of products with an emphasis on continual delivery while not overburdening the development team. How kanbanstyle development gives us another way to deliver on agile values years ago feb 25th 2008 to be exact i wrote this draft article. At the training jens coldewey from itagile came up to me and asked if i would be interested in starting a limited wip society group in munich like arne roock and bernd schiffer already did in hamburg. Discussion will include how kanban method practitioners may benefit.

Understanding kanban method or kanban framework for software development. Limit work in process wip get more done by doing less. Personal kanban is an approach to managing work that helps individuals get more done with less stress. If you want to be super super strict about your terminology, kanban isnt a subset of agile. Kanban is proving useful to teams doing agile software development but equally it is. Jan 17, 2014 with a functioning kanban system, we have data that allows us to make informed, economically sound decisions about improvements and a mindset that we are going to improve incrementally and in an evolutionary manner. What is the best agile methodology for a project with just.

She wanted to run a new initiative in her program and she asked us to help with scrum adoption, because she liked certain principles of the scrum framework. Pdf kanban methodology is very significant philosophy which plays an important role in many production units. Getting started with agile developement using the atlassian. A key verification challenge is the ability to coordinate and focus.

Board of directors henrik kniberg agile lean coach. Introduction to agile values and principles articulating agile values and principles understandi. This approach aims to manage work by balancing demands with available capacity, and by improving the handling of systemlevel bottlenecks. Use kanban to maximize efficiency, predictability, quality, and value with kanban, every minute you spend on a software project can add value for customers. Kanban jest przedstawiany jako czesc inicjatywy lean pozwalajaca zmieniac kulture organizacji i zachecac do ciaglego usprawniania procesu. Arne roock how a team can evaluate whether kanban is the right tool, and how to kick it off. Kanban method the pull production system invented by toyota will be analyzed and shown useful to coordinate and improve design and knowledgebased work in the construction industry. Aug 12, 2015 our kanban evolves as our context changes, encouraging us to response promptly to daily changes.

Our goal was to help our stakeholders to make a carefully weighed and considered. Kanban is a visual system for managing work as it moves through a process. This approach aims to manage work by balancing demands with available capacity, and by improving the handling of systemlevel bottlenecks work items are visualized to give participants a view of progress and process, from start to finishusually via a kanban board. Scrum and kanban have their benefits and pitfalls and are appropriate for different audits and situations. This strategy takes the kanban system, which originated in japanese factories, and applies it in a personal context. At the time kanban development was a cool new thing bleeding edge agile. Kanban a lean approach to agile software development jfokus january 26, 2010 henrik. Agile project management with kanban i have been fortunate to work closely with eric for many years. Getting started with kanban 3 getting started with kanban finding ways to do things more efficiently is becoming a necessity no matter what business youre in.

Kanban limits wip per workflow state, scrum limits wip per iteration. Use of kanban method in a variety of design applications will be explained. Kanban for dummies learning how to use the kanban method for project management processes may seem like a daunting task at first. For us agile coaches, it was important that our stakeholders made the decision, instead of the classic case where the client relies solely on the consultants recommendations. His philosophy and approach to software engineering are truly. Last week i attended an awesome kanban training with david anderson. Lean is a general term for finding ways to eliminate waste and increase efficiency. The agile methodology, who knew a significant increase in influence and use by the it development industry in the past two decades, is based on various newer or older methods. Author eric brechner pioneered kanban within the xbox engineering team at microsoft. Lean manufacturing it is a comprehensive set of techniques that, when combined and matured, will allow you to reduce and then eliminate the waste from a company. While this was technically incorrect the term kanban board had sneaked into the vocabulary of agile and software development and is in usage. Kanban jest uzyteczny dla zespolow pracujacych w metodyce agile, ostatnio jednak zyskuje rowniez popularnosc wsrod zespolow wykorzystujacych bardziej tradycyjne podejscie. We are actually slaying a software development dragon with a 12 punch of agile manifesto thinking and kanban method thinking.

Kanban in manufacturing is the inspiration behind what we now call kanban for software engineering. Within the middle and back office operations, approximately 48% have experience in agile working, ranking second place. It may seem counterintuitive, but it is a powerful idea that has been proven time and time again to be true. Although kanban offers several benefits, as reported in this dissertation, the findings show that software companies find it challenging to implement kanban incrementally. An introduction to kanban methodology for agile software development and its benefits for your agile team. As agile methodologies are becoming more popular, more companies try to adapt them. With a functioning kanban system, we have data that allows us to make informed, economically sound decisions about improvements and a mindset that we are going to improve incrementally and in an evolutionary manner. Index termsagile, kanban, lean manufacturing, asicfpga management.

1422 87 459 1482 714 733 1472 146 442 357 468 660 1389 761 1399 157 614 1488 758 1355 1202 51 580 284 1089 228 489 1037 449 351 239 1134 393 1367 1308 402 1466 1414 672 541 1085 1259 384 399